Recipe Highlights
- Place boneless, skinless chicken breasts in the crockpot and cover with quality marinara sauce and Italian seasoning.
- Cook on low for 6 to 8 hours until chicken is tender and easily shredded.
- Shred the chicken in the pot and mix it thoroughly with the marinara sauce.
- Serve the shredded chicken on crusty rolls or buns for a delicious sandwich.
- Enhance your sandwich with toppings like arugula, coleslaw, or red pepper flakes for added flavor.

- Choose the Right Chicken: Opt for boneless, skinless chicken breasts or thighs. They shred beautifully and absorb the marinara flavors perfectly.
- Fresh Marinara Sauce: If possible, use homemade marinara or a high-quality store-bought version. The richness and depth of flavor in a good sauce can elevate your sandwiches from average to outstanding.

How Long Does Shredded Chicken Last in the Refrigerator?
You've got some delicious shredded chicken in your fridge, but how long can you safely enjoy it?
Typically, cooked shredded chicken lasts about three to four days when properly stored in an airtight container.
Keep your eyes peeled for any signs of spoilage, like odd smells or discoloration.
